1) IRA Contributions
Let’s get those retirement accounts funded for both 2020 and 2021! For both years, the IRA limit is $6k per person per year ($7k per year if you are over 50). For 2020 contributions, the deadline is 4/15/2021. 

2) Self-employed retirement plans
With 2020 over, now is a good time to figure out how much you can put into your company retirement plan (e.g., solo 401k, SEP IRA). Typically, you have until the normal tax filing deadline of April 15th, plus extensions, to fund these types of plans.
